Nand and nor Gates
OBSERVATION TABLE:
A B Q=(A+B)’
0 0 1
0 1 0
1 0 0
1 1 0
Truth Table 2-1 for NOR gate
A B Q=(A*B)’
0 0 1
0 1 1
1 0 1
1 1 0
Truth Table 2-2 for NAND gate
QUESTIONS / RESULTS:
1. Why are NAND and NOR gates called universal gates?
Ans. NAND and NOR gates are called universal gates because they can perform all logical
operations of basic gates like AND, OR and NOT by using these gates. Universal gates are
logic gate that are used to construct other logic gates.
1. If the 0 and 1 were inputs for a NAND gate, what would be the output?
Ans. If one of the inputs were high (1) and other is low (0) to the NAND gate then the
resulting value will be high (1).
2. If a signal passing through a gate is inhibited by sending a LOW into one of the
inputs, and the output is HIGH, the gate is an NAND
3. When used with an IC, what does the term "QUAD" indicates?
Ans. When used with an IC, QUAD indicates 4 circuits.
